What is Redis?

Redis, which stands for Remote Dictionary Server, is an open-source, in-memory key-value store known for its speed and versatility. Unlike traditional databases, Redis operates entirely in memory, making data retrieval exceptionally fast. It supports various data structures, including strings, hashes, lists, sets, and sorted sets, making it ideal for diverse caching needs.

Benefits of Using Redis for Caching in Laravel

  • Speed: Redis provides sub-millisecond response times, significantly reducing the time needed to retrieve cached data.
  • Scalability: Redis can handle massive datasets and high-throughput operations, making it suitable for growing applications.
  • Persistence: While primarily an in-memory store, Redis can persist data to disk, allowing data recovery in case of failures.
  • Data Structures: Its support for advanced data types allows for more complex caching strategies.

Setting Up Redis in Laravel

Integrating Redis into your Laravel application is straightforward. Laravel has built-in support for Redis through its cache and session services, which makes implementation seamless.

Step 1: Install Redis

First, ensure that you have Redis installed on your server. If you’re using a local development environment, you can install Redis using Homebrew on macOS:

brew install redis

For Ubuntu, you can use:

sudo apt update
sudo apt install redis-server

Step 2: Install the Laravel Redis Package

Laravel requires the predis/predis package to communicate with Redis. You can install it via Composer:

composer require predis/predis

Step 3: Configure Redis in Laravel

Once Redis is installed, you need to configure it in your Laravel application. Open the .env file and set the Redis connection parameters:

REDIS_HOST=127.0.0.1
REDIS_PASSWORD=null
REDIS_PORT=6379

Next, Laravel’s default configuration for Redis is located in config/database.php. Ensure that the Redis section matches your .env settings.

Using Redis for Caching

Now that Redis is set up, let’s explore how to use it as a caching solution in your Laravel application.

Caching Data with Redis

You can cache data in Redis using the Laravel Cache facade. The following example demonstrates how to cache a query result:

use Illuminate\Support\Facades\Cache;

$data = Cache::remember('users', 60, function () {
    return DB::table('users')->get();
});

In this example: - remember checks if the data associated with the key users exists in the cache. - If it does, it returns the cached data. - If not, it executes the query and caches the result for 60 minutes.

Cache Invalidation

Cache invalidation is crucial to ensure that stale data isn’t served to users. You can manually remove cached data using the forget method:

Cache::forget('users');

You can also use cache tags for more fine-grained control. This is particularly useful when caching related data:

Cache::tags(['user', 'admin'])->put('user_profile', $userProfile, 60);

You can then invalidate all cached data related to users or admins easily:

Cache::tags(['user'])->flush();

Advanced Use Cases for Redis

Session Management

Redis can also be used to manage sessions in Laravel, providing a fast and efficient way to store session data. To use Redis for sessions, update your .env file:

SESSION_DRIVER=redis

Then, Laravel will automatically use Redis for session storage.

Rate Limiting

With Redis, you can implement rate limiting for your APIs. Laravel provides a simple way to handle this using middleware:

Route::middleware('throttle:10,1')->group(function () {
    Route::get('/api/resource', 'ResourceController@index');
});

This limits access to the route to 10 requests per minute.

Troubleshooting Common Issues

Redis Connection Issues

If you encounter issues connecting to Redis, check the following:

  • Ensure Redis is running: Use redis-cli ping to check if Redis is active.
  • Verify your configuration in the .env file.
  • Check your firewall settings to ensure that the Redis port (default: 6379) is open.

Performance Bottlenecks

If you notice performance issues, consider the following optimizations:

  • Use appropriate data structures: Choose the right data type for your caching needs (e.g., use hashes for user sessions).
  • Monitor your Redis instance: Use tools like Redis Monitor to diagnose performance issues and optimize queries.
